Lisa Kennedy (Born 1963) is an Australian fine artist born in Melbourne, Victoria. She works as a writer, painter and illustrator. Lisa uses mixed media for her works. She is a graduate of Victoria College of the Arts where she earned a diploma of Visual Art in 2002. While still young, her father introduced her to the sea, great rocks, and the stars. She also grew up loving trees and other plants. Painting became her way of expressing herself at a very young age. It's through art that she was able to let her emotions free. At some point, she started painting for indigenous people who would ask her to paint specific stories while at times she would simply be asked to create a story and tell it through her painting. Lisa started looking into her roots and managed to achieve some level of information that consequently gave her some spiritual refreshment. Her only way to fit within the contemporary setting was through her artwork.

In 1994, Lisa self published a book and followed it with a children's book in 1995. In 2000, she wrote another book for her son to give him spiritual strength since they had to stay apart. The book is called "Nick's Amazing Journey." She's currently preparing one of her books for publication; a series of 72 watercolor paintings that have been compiled in form of a story. She has also done a lot of community projects in arts and has created and directed a puppetry performance. Lisa has created several works that cover a host of subjects such as laundry accessories, nature, country homes, and Christmas art.
